Transmission routes of visceral leishmaniasis in mammals
<p>Visceral leishmaniasis (VL) is a chronic disease caused by<bold> Leishmania infantum</bold>. The major sites of parasite localization in infected animals are the secondary lymphoid organs, bone marrow and cutaneous tissue. However, reports exist on the detection of the parasite...
